About Airwallex

Airwallex is the only unified payments and financial platform for global businesses. Powered by our unique combination of proprietary infrastructure and software, we empower over 150,000 businesses worldwide – including Brex, Rippling, Navan, Qantas, SHEIN and many more – with fully integrated solutions to manage everything from business accounts, payments, spend management and treasury, to embedded finance at a global scale.

Proudly founded in Melbourne, we have a team of over 1,700 of the brightest and most innovative people in tech across more than 37 locations around the globe. Valued at US$5.6 billion and backed by world-leading investors including Sequoia, Lone Pine, Greenoaks, DST Global, Salesforce Ventures and Mastercard, Airwallex is leading the charge in building the global payments and financial platform of the future. What you’ll do

Airwallex is seeking a strategic and results-driven VP, Marketing to accelerate growth and scale our North America business. Reporting directly to the President, Americas, you will collaborate closely with commercial and strategy teams, acting as a versatile B2B marketing leader. Your primary focus will be to drive customer acquisition through a blend of online and offline channels.

This is a senior leadership role offering a unique opportunity to significantly impact our North America market presence. We are looking for a proactive, creative, and data-focused leader who can strategize, execute, test, and optimize marketing initiatives.

This role is based in San Francisco, CA.

Responsibilities:

  • Own Marketing strategy and planning - develop a comprehensive B2B Marketing strategy across all channels to acquire and retain customers to support the US businesses.

  • Drive performance marketing - work with the North America Commercial team and Global Marketing team to plan and execute online performance campaigns including paid social, display, and SEM.

  • Manage offline marketing campaigns - analyze opportunities and own the launch of offline campaigns, including first-and third-party events.

  • Oversee local product launches - work with our strategy, go-to-market, and Product Marketing teams to launch new products in the Americas.

  • Drive content marketing - partner with the Content Marketing team to lay out and execute a comprehensive content strategy, including industry-specific white papers.

  • Optimize CRM strategy - work with the account management team and Global Marketing team to scale and optimize email marketing campaigns.

  • Performance management - review, discuss, and analyze the current performance of marketing campaigns and iterate based on early findings.

  • Deliver insights - surface customer insights that enrich our understanding of our buyer personas, and craft a value proposition that resonates with key segments.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
